Abstract
<jats:p>Cyclic adenosine monophosphate (cAMP) is a second messenger that regulates various cellular processes, including the activity of hyperpolarization-activated channels (HCN), which are implicated in cardiac physiology and neurodegenerative diseases such as Parkinson's disease (PD). In this study, we used a photoactivated adenylyl cyclase (PAC) S27A mutant to optogenetically control intracellular cAMP levels. We demonstrated that light-induced elevation of cAMP activated HCN4 channels, leading to increased beating rates in cardiomyocytes. Unilateral expression of PAC(S27A) in the substantia nigra pars compacta of mice induced rotation behavior upon light stimulation, which could be attenuated by HCN inhibitors. Furthermore, PAC(S27A) activation partially recovered motor deficits in a 1-methyl-4-phenyl-1,2,3,6-tetrahydropyridine (MPTP)-induced PD mouse model, accompanied by increased HCN2 channel expression in ipsilateral basal ganglia. Our findings highlight the potential of using optogenetics to modulate cAMP and HCN channel activity for the treatment of cardiac and neurological disorders.</jats:p>
